Built in 1690, this church houses the beautiful image of Our Lady of the Abandoned (Nstra. Sra. delos Desamparados) which was canonically crowned in 2005 by Cardinal Gaudencio Rosales in the name of Pope Benedict XVI. The church is the second oldest parish in the Philippines dedicated to Our Lady of the Abandoned. The church has undergone major renovations and improvements to restore it to its former grandeur.
